OSHA Inspection: PORT CITY LOGISTICS, INC.
Complaint inspection · Safety discipline
At a glance
On , OSHA opened a complaint safety inspection of PORT CITY LOGISTICS, INC. in 122 NORWEST CT, SAVANNAH, GA 31407 (NAICS 493110). OSHA activity number 348829821.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1904.32(b)(6): The OSHA 300-A Summary was not posted by February 1 of the year following the year covered by the records and/or kept in place until April 30. a) At the facility, on or about March 24, 2026, the OSHA 300A summary for calendar year 2025 was not posted.

29 CFR 1910.178(a)(4): Capacity, operation, and maintenance instruction plates, tags or decals of the powered industrial truck were not changed accordingly: a) At the facility: On or about March 24, 2026, and times prior to, the employer exposed employees to struck-by hazard, in that the UniCarriers, Model #MCP1F2A25LV, Serial# CP1F22-9W38579 was equipped with a clamp attachment that was not approved by the manufacturer.

29 CFR 1910.178(a)(5): The powered industrial truck was equipped with front-end attachments other than factory installed attachments, however the employer did not request that the truck be marked to identify the attachments and show the approximate weight of the truck and attachment combination at maximum elevation with load laterally centered: a) At the facility: On or about March 24, 2026, and times prior to, the employer exposed employees to a struck-by hazard, in that there were no markings to identify the clamp attachment and show the approximate weight of the truck and attachment combination at maximum elevation with the load laterally centered, nor were the load charts updated on the UniCarriers, Model #MCP1F2A25LV, Serial# CP1F22-9W38579 to reflect the clamp attachment.

29 CFR 1910.178(l)(3)(i)(G): Powered industrial truck operators did not receive initial training on fork and attachment adaptation, operation, and use limitations: a) At the facility: On or about March 24, 2026, and times prior to, the employer exposed employees to a struck-by hazard, in that training on fork attachment adaptation, operation and limitations specific to clamp attachment used on the Uni Carrier was not provided to operators.
